Here’s How To Avoid Painful Post-Lockdown Tooth Decay – Lifehacker Australia
It was found that less than half of adults had visited a dentist in the past 12 months. Here’s how to avoid post-lockdown tooth decay.

When was the last time you visited the dentist? Its a question worth asking after a recent survey found half of UK parents say their children have missed a check-up since COVID-19 restrictions were introduced.
According to The Guardian, dentists are fearing a tsunami of untreated tooth decay due to missed check-ups and dental surgeries during lockdown. Our big worry is children, whose tooth enamel is softer and thinner, and more vulnerable to sugary lockdown diets, Association of Dental Groups …
